The ongoing dispute over the UK's defence investment plan has cast a shadow over the government's unity, with sources revealing a deeply fractured cabinet. This situation, marked by intense infighting, has significantly damaged the relationships between key ministers, particularly between the Ministry of Defence, the Treasury, and Downing Street. The tension stems from the Ministry of Defence's initial assurance that their plans were fully costed and didn't require additional funding, only to later request billions more. This sudden about-face infuriated the Treasury, which refused to budge, leading to a months-long standoff. The prime minister, Keir Starmer, finds himself in a delicate position, balancing the need for robust defence spending with the economic growth promised to the public. Starmer's spokesperson emphasizes the importance of getting the defence investment plan (Dip) right, ensuring the UK delivers the best equipment and technology to its frontline forces while also investing in and growing the economy. However, the reality is more complex. The defence secretary, John Healey, was forced to ask for more money due to escalating global conflicts, which increased demands on his department's budget. This includes commitments to the 'coalition of the willing' in Ukraine and a potential mission in the Strait of Hormuz. The Treasury's refusal to sign off on additional funding above £12 billion, despite Healey's request for around £18 billion, highlights the tension between defence and economic priorities. The energy and transport departments have agreed to larger cuts to fund the additional spending, with the transport secretary successfully lobbying to avoid reductions in spending on new buses, trains, and potentially even HS2. The Treasury will take control of a multibillion-pound fighter jet programme in return for agreeing to the funding, but the chancellor is understood to be frustrated about having to cut projects that would promote growth to pay for promises she believed were fully costed. The long-delayed Dip, which the prime minister has promised to announce before a NATO summit early next month, represents a pivotal moment for the government.
